@hickend, you might want to consider using google calendar solely for your scheduling with your Bishop. I'm the asst executive secretary in my stake presidency. I schedule the meetings for the two counselors. The church provided calendar is great for general meetings for your stake/ward, but it's just not as good as calendar sharing as google. I had the counselors create special gmail addresses for their calling and then had them share the google calendar that is automatically created for that email with me. I can then schedule it for them and they can see it on their iPads/work computer without having to go to lds.org. Plus it has a great daily agenda print option. It's worked out really well. Plus the Executive Sec can see the appointments and can even modify them as well.

He's not the only one asking. I submitted a request via Feedback long ago, but not via this forum. And I'm quite certain he and I are not the only two ExecSecs in the world that use LDS calendar to schedule appointments for the Bishop/SP, and then find there is no means to print out enough detail from within LDS calendar.

But in the meantime (and mainly because I'm too lazy to go to Google to print it out), here's what I have been doing. I go to the front page of the Leader Resources, and at the right is a column for Schedule. You can elect to "Show More", but it lays out the agenda for the next few days line by line. By printing that, the priesthood leader sees his appointments plus times for any other events coming up.

Works decent.
